WFTPD Pro Server 3.23 Buffer Overflow
-------------------------------------
A buffer overflow was found in the APPE command when
passing (as first) a long string
with slashes and/or backslashes. The exploit is
clearly exploitable as overwritting EIP
is quite easy but I'm too lazy...
Attached goes an (unfinished) POC.
